A Healthy Public Policy, Who’s Effectiveness bas been Proven: Restriction of Liquor Sales Hour

This study sought to relate the impact of the time restriction on liquor sales with violent deaths due to alcohol consumption. In 2011 based on an ecological comparison study between 2 districts of Lima, one with restriction and one without, evidenced the difference in the incidence of injuries of external cause related to alcohol. Therefore, the municipality of Lima promulgated ordinance 1586, which established the restriction of liquor sales hours in the 43 districts that make up metropolitan Lima and gave a period of 3 years to establish it. The Institute of Legal Medicine of Lima sent monthly the ethnographic characteristics of violent deaths related to alcohol. This ordinance has shown that it is capable of reducing violent deaths related to alcohol in traffic crashes, hit-and-runs, homicides, and suicides, fundamentally in men, young people, days of the week and time of the greatest incidence. There was also an increase in the age frequency of deaths of traffic accidents by year of the ordinance
